Current Scenario:
The Ore & Metal Refinery industry in the CIS region is thriving, driven by the rich abundance of mineral resources and substantial investments in infrastructure development. Countries like Russia, Kazakhstan, and Ukraine are among the key players in this sector due to their extensive mineral deposits and well-established refinery facilities. For instance, Russia's Norilsk Nickel is one of the world's largest producers of palladium and nickel, with headquarters in Norilsk, a city renowned for its nickel production.
Construction of New Projects:
The construction of new projects in the CIS region's Ore & Metal Refinery industry is boosting the overall capacity and efficiency of the sector. Major players are investing in modernizing their existing facilities while new refineries are being built to cater to the increasing demand for metals. Take Magnitogorsk Iron and Steel Works (MMK) in Russia, for example, which recently completed the construction of a new hot-dip galvanizing unit, enhancing its capacity and enabling the production of high-quality steel products for both domestic and international markets.
Major Drivers:
Several factors contribute to the growth and development of the Ore & Metal Refinery industry in the CIS region. Firstly, strong government support and policies aimed at attracting foreign investments and promoting local production act as key drivers. Governments across the region are implementing measures to reduce bureaucratic hurdles and enhance industry-specific regulations. For instance, Kazakhstan has established the Astana International Financial Centre (AIFC) to provide a business-friendly environment for investors and support the development of the metal refinery sector.
Secondly, the increasing demand for metals globally is propelling the industry's growth. The CIS region's vast reserves of iron ore, copper, gold, and other valuable minerals position it as a significant supplier to the global market. The industry is witnessing a surge in demand from developing countries such as China, which heavily relies on imports for its metal requirements. This demand is driving the expansion of existing refineries and spurring the construction of new projects.
